    I have used one! There is cotton stuffing inside so you can tweak the size a bit if you need to. It is very lightweight and for some that is a problem as they need a little bit of weight to hold the bra down.  I have used it inside of my compression bra with my swell spot to even me up and it worked well for that.

    Awesome Breastforms

    Giving you back your curves. For those with mastectomies, not having reconstruction.

    Wonderful news... Our very active group of volunteers has been busy knitting and crocheting breast forms for those having a mastectomy without reconstruction. These forms are lighter and cooler than the silicone forms to wear and are made using soft 100% cotton. They are available in cup sizes from A to DD. We will take special orders such as larger sizes, lumpectomies, on requests. You are welcome to choose forms in light and dark skin tones, pastels or go really funky with wild & crazy ones, nipples or no nipples. Because we crochet and knit the orders as they come in, we do our best to give you the colour choice. We do send them around the world so don't be afraid to ask if you want your curves back.
